We often believe success is a solo act, that if you’re talented enough, you can muscle your way through any room. But Dennis Quaid offers a more generous truth: “I want to work with great people. Great people really make you better.” It’s not a surrender of ambition; it’s a smarter form of it.
Great people don’t just raise results; they raise your standards. In their presence, excuses sound louder, preparation becomes normal, and “good enough” stops feeling safe. The bar is no longer theoretical, it’s alive in the way they show up, ask questions, handle pressure, and recover from mistakes without drama. That kind of proximity turns improvement from an intention into a routine.
To apply this, think less about finding “networking opportunities” and more about choosing environments that force you to earn your confidence. Seek colleagues who are demanding and generous at once, precise with feedback, clear about goals, and free of ego games. Then do your part: be coachable, bring energy instead of noise, and protect the team’s leadership standards. Your growth accelerates when you stop asking, “How do I look?” and start asking, “What does the work require?”
Quaid’s perspective carries weight because his decades-long career across film, television, and music has been built in high-stakes collaborations where chemistry, discipline, and trust determine whether a project sings or stalls.
Today, send one message to someone whose craft you respect: ask a specific question, request a critique, or offer help on a concrete task, then follow through within 24 hours. Choose the room that stretches you, and let success become a shared habit you can carry forward.
